Get started40 Brackley Close is an end-of-terrace house in Wallington (SM6 9JR). It has a recorded floor area of 89 m² (around 958 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(October 2024) shows a C (score 71). When first surveyed in March 2013 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Average to Poor and ro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 9.5%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£313,000 is 46.3% above the 2015 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£223/sq ft) was about 37.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. On the market in March 2015 and unlisted since — roughly 11 years.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property.
40 Brackley Close has more than quadrupled in price since its earliest registered sale in 1997.
